The Saba Capital Income & Opportunities Fund, listed on the New York Stock Exchange under the ticker symbol BRW, is a type of investment fund that focuses on generating income for its shareholders. With an ISIN of US92913A1007, this fund is categorized as a bank loan fund, which means it primarily invests in senior secured loans made to corporations. These loans are typically backed by collateral and have a higher claim on assets than other types of debt, making them a relatively safer investment option. The fund's investment strategy involves actively managing a portfolio of bank loans to achieve its investment objectives, which include providing a high level of current income and preserving capital.

As a bank loan fund, BRW invests in a diversified portfolio of senior secured loans, which are often floating-rate instruments. This means that the interest rates on these loans adjust periodically based on changes in market interest rates. The fund's investment manager, Saba Capital, uses a disciplined approach to select loans that meet the fund's investment criteria, with a focus on credit quality, yield, and liquidity. By investing in a broad range of senior secured loans, the fund aims to reduce its exposure to any one particular industry or borrower, thereby minimizing credit risk. Additionally, the fund's portfolio is actively managed to take advantage of opportunities in the bank loan market, such as investing in loans with attractive yields or participating in loan restructurings.
